About Merken
Merken is a restaurant, brewpub, espresso bar, and wine bar in San Martín de los Andes, Neuquén Province. Reviewers consistently praise the friendly staff, generous portions, and strong gluten free options, with many noting that the food and drinks are reliable for breakfast, lunch, and dinner. It is described as a casual, cozy, and quiet place on the main street, with outdoor seating, free WiFi, and a bar-focused menu that includes beer, cocktails, coffee, and wine. The price range is ARS 20–40K, and several reviews say the value is good for the portion size and quality.

Frequently asked questions
What is Merken known for?
Merken is best known for its gluten free-friendly menu and hearty dishes like milanesa with chips, burgers, and breakfast items such as gluten free toast and medialunas. Reviewers also consistently mention the friendly service and generous portions, which make it a standout for both meals and drinks.
What dishes are most recommended at Merken?
Reviewers most often highlight the milanesa with chips, burgers, trout, gnocchi, onion soup, and breakfast items like gluten free toast and medialunas. Other specific dishes praised in reviews include the chorizo steak and salmon, especially for their flavor and portion size.
What is the atmosphere like at Merken?
Merken is described as casual, cozy, quiet, and trendy, with outdoor seating and a bar-cafe feel. It seems to suit solo diners, groups, and people working on a laptop, since reviewers mention spending long stretches there and feeling welcomed by the staff.
Is Merken good value, and what is the price range?
Merken falls in the ARS 20–40K range, and reviewers give mixed but mostly positive value feedback, with several saying the prices are good for the quality and generous portions. A few mention it feels a little pricey, but many still call the food, drinks, and overall experience worth it.
